Margherita Civil Hospital revives Ayurveda

Over 700 patients treated with Panchakarma therapy

MARGHERITA, Dec 30: Margherita FRU Civil Hospital in Assam’s Tinsukia district has emerged as a beacon of hope for patients seeking holistic and traditional medical treatments.

- Advertisement -

Since March 8, 2019, under the dedicated guidance of Dr Sashindra Barman, Margherita co-district medical officer and a passionate advocate for Ayurveda, the hospital has been offering Panchakarma therapy—a cornerstone of Ayurvedic medicine.

Panchakarma, a detoxification and rejuvenation therapy has successfully treated over 700 patients suffering from a range of ailments, including paralysis, neurological disorders, skin-related problems, arthritis, and even poisoning.

This ancient form of treatment uses herbal remedies and natural therapies to restore balance and promote health, drawing from a 5,000-year-old tradition that was once on the verge of extinction.

The word “Ayurveda,” derived from the Sanskrit terms Ayur (life) and Veda (science or knowledge), literally means “the science of life.”

“It emphasises a balanced lifestyle and natural healing. Through relentless efforts, this traditional medical practice has found a new lease of life at Margherita Civil Hospital, where more than 700 critically ill patients from across Assam and neighboring states like Arunachal Pradesh, Nagaland, and Meghalaya have been cured,” said Dr Sashindra Barman.

It is worth mentioning that Dr Sashindra Barman’s work highlights the importance of preserving and integrating ancient wisdom into modern healthcare.

“Patients undergoing Panchakarma therapy at the hospital have reported significant improvements in their health. The holistic approach not only addresses physical ailments but also promotes mental well-being, making it a preferred choice for many seeking alternative treatments,” added Barman.

Margherita Civil Hospital’s success story is a testament to the enduring relevance of Ayurveda in today’s medical landscape. It showcases how traditional systems of medicine, when practiced with dedication and expertise, can complement modern healthcare and offer effective solutions to chronic conditions, he said.
